Transaction cda9033b684d88466c455196c8ab3049035322af8f9352743ffbd4fc99ece87e
1 Input
1 Output
-
cda9033b684d88466c455196c8ab3049035322af8f9352743ffbd4fc99ece87e:0
- value
- 3085941
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8a52a4a574194619da452ba32f385057f90a21aa OP_EQUAL
- address
- 3EJQBAQmSC7zpGMZkSDmZHDN8setVN46ny